You can access the following directory information for students.
- Names – nicknames for students who don’t use their record name.
- Addresses – campus, dorm and home addresses
- Phone numbers – cell, dorm and home numbers
- E-mail address – campus e-mail
- Photos
Please remember that although this is directory information, it is made available to you solely for use in your role as academic advisors and faculty. This information should not be shared outside the Williams community. If you receive a request for any of this information from individuals or organizations off-campus, please refer the request to the Registrar’s Office. If a student has asked that some directory information be limited, it may not display on these pages.

Names

The Preferred name may show a nickname if the student uses something other than his or her record name.
Addresses

Current students will have a campus (SU Box) address, a dorm/local address (if enrolled on campus), a Home address, and sometimes a Mailing Address (SU Box or Summer address). To view all addresses, either click through the arrows on the blue bar or click on the blue bar to display all addresses.
Phones

Phone numbers are maintained while a student is enrolled. Once graduated, the cell and home phone numbers may be out of date.
E-Mail Addresses

If a Home e-mail address displays, this is from the Admission record and may or may not be outdated.
Photo

An ID photo will be available for most students.
